762 FZUS72 KMLB 111113 MWSMLB Marine Weather Statement National Weather Service Melbourne FL 713 AM EDT Thu Jul 11 2024 AMZ550-552-570-572-111245- 713 AM EDT Thu Jul 11 2024 ...STRONG THUNDERSTORMS OVER THE WATERS... The areas affected include... Flagler Beach to Volusia-Brevard County Line 0-20 nm... Flagler Beach to Volusia-Brevard County Line 20-60 nm... Volusia-Brevard County Line to Sebastian Inlet 0-20 nm... Volusia-Brevard County Line to Sebastian Inlet 20-60 nm... At 713 AM EDT, Doppler radar indicated strong thunderstorms, capable of producing winds to around 30 knots. These thunderstorms were located along a line extending from near Maytown to 54 nm east of Playalinda Beach, moving southeast at 20 knots.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... Mariners can expect gusty winds to around 30 knots, locally higher waves, and lightning strikes. Boaters should seek safe harbor immediately until these storms pass. && LAT...LON 2884 8085 2892 8089 2902 7968 2866 7955 2830 7954 2817 8069 2865 8085 2881 8089 $$ Schaper
